About The Queen's Head Hotel

Located 4 miles from Ambleside and Windermere and nestled on the side of the fells which overlook the Troutbeck Valley stands The Queens Head, a 17th century coaching inn. The new Queens Head features a cosy drinking area with newly-refurbished dining areas and 10 comfortable en-suite guest bedrooms providing the perfect base for guests to Cumbria and, of course, their four legged companions. Renowned for serving some of the finest food in the area, The Queens Head’s new menu will highlight a mixture of homely classic pub food with a Cumbrian flair. So, whether stopping by for a pint of one of Robinsons award-winning cask ales, enjoying some wholesome home-cooked food or staying the night, you are always guaranteed to receive a warm Lakeland welcome when visiting the Queens Head.

Facilities & Amenities
The hotel offers a welcoming bar area that serves as a vibrant social hub, contributing significantly to the overall atmosphere and providing an attractive space for dining. For guests with mobility needs, an elevator is available, ensuring accessibility throughout the property. The hotel goes above and beyond for canine guests, providing dedicated paw washing taps and a designated dog toilet area, highlighting its commitment to being truly dog-friendly. Additionally, guests can enjoy a pleasant beer garden and the inviting warmth of a roaring fire in communal areas. While the facilities are highly praised, some guests expressed a desire for more dedicated lounge seating or additional chairs in rooms to fully appreciate the scenic views.


Cleanliness & Room Comfort
Guests consistently commend the spotless cleanliness and high-standard decor of the rooms, which are described as both spacious and exceptionally comfortable. The modern bathrooms, often featuring wet rooms or lovely showers and baths, contribute to a luxurious feel. Thoughtful touches such as provided toiletries, bathrobes, slippers, complimentary beer, flapjacks, and fresh milk in a flask are frequently appreciated, enhancing the overall guest experience. Many rooms offer lovely views, adding to the appeal. However, some guests noted that rooms could be too warm, even with a fan, and a few mentioned minor issues such as mini fridge noise, hard pillows, curtains not fully closing, slow bathroom drainage, limited storage, or occasional noise from other rooms or the adjacent road in front-facing accommodations.


Dining & Food Quality
The excellent food is a consistent highlight, with guests overwhelmingly praising both the dinner and breakfast offerings. The evening meals are frequently described as proper home-cooked pub grub, leading many guests to choose to dine at the hotel every night due to the high quality and inviting atmosphere. The breakfast receives high acclaim for its variety, including fresh pastries, juices, and a choice of hot meals, often noted as being filling and superb. A unique and much-appreciated feature is the dedicated dog menu, which significantly enhances the experience for dog owners. While the feedback is overwhelmingly positive, some guests found certain evening meals to be satisfactory but not exceptional, and a few specific comments mentioned a desire for more vegetarian options or particular condiments.


Location & Accessibility
The hotel boasts a superb location in the Lake District, making it an ideal base for walkers and those seeking a peaceful getaway. Guests highly appreciate the easy access to walks directly from the hotel's doorstep, including routes into Ambleside and the surrounding hills. It is conveniently situated close enough to Windermere to allow exploration without being in the midst of its hustle and bustle. While the rural setting is a major draw, some guests noted the hotel's proximity to a busy road, which could lead to traffic noise in rooms facing it. For those preferring amenities within close walking distance, the location is described as somewhat remote, requiring walks along the main road to reach other points of interest.


Staff & Service
The staff consistently receive high praise for their friendliness, attentiveness, and exceptional service. Guests frequently highlight the warm welcome received upon arrival and the team's willingness to go above and beyond, making every effort to ensure a comfortable stay. The dog-friendly service is particularly noted, with staff treating canine companions with great care, even providing dog treats and breakfast sausages. While the overall service is outstanding, a few guests observed that the level of welcome and friendliness can occasionally vary if key leadership staff are not present, though this does not detract significantly from the positive experience. The staff's professionalism and efficiency are also commended, contributing to a relaxed and enjoyable atmosphere.


Additional Information
The hotel is exceptionally dog-friendly, going above and beyond to accommodate pets with amenities like a dedicated dog menu, breakfast sausages for canine guests, paw washing taps, and even bags for dirty boots for walkers. Guests appreciate the thoughtful touches such as fresh milk provided for in-room hot drinks. While the hotel caters well to various needs, some guests suggested that breakfast could start earlier to accommodate early risers, particularly walkers aiming to maximize daylight hours. There was also feedback regarding the desire for more vegetarian options on the menu and a preference for less plastic packaging for items like marmalade, indicating a potential for enhanced sustainability efforts. One guest mentioned a small wardrobe in their room, which might be a consideration for longer stays.
